THE BOOK OF ACTS AUGUST 24, 2025
SHARING OUR LIVES

SCRIPTURE
All the believers were one in heart and mind. No one claimed that any of their possessions was their own, but they shared everything they had. With great power the apostles continued to testify to the resurrection of the Lord Jesus. And God’s grace was so powerfully at work in them all that there were no needy persons among them. For from time to time those who owned land or houses sold them, brought the money from the sales and put it at the apostles’ feet, and it was distributed to anyone who had need. Acts 4:32-35

This text clearly speaks about people sharing their finances, but it’s more… “Where your treasure is, there your heart will be also.” Matthew 6:21

They loved their community so much, they even shared their money!


THE CONCEPT OF KONONIA

“Koinōnia” is the idea of shared lives.

The Lord God said, “It is not good for the man to be alone.” Genesis 2:18

Two people are better off than one, for they can help each other succeed. Eccl 4:9

All the believers devoted themselves to fellowship. Acts 2:42

And let us not neglect our meeting together, as some people do. Hebrews 10:25

Let us do good to all people, especially to those who belong to the family of believers. Galatians 6:10

Specific examples are Jonathan and David, Ruth and Naomi, Paul and Barnabas.

Meaningful relationships aren’t found. They’re forged.

HOW WE CAN SHARE OUR LIVES

Wherever we connect, here are some keys to forging healthy relationships:

1/ We should seek unity of heart (v.32).

At the Tower of Babel, God said nothing would be impossible because of their unity.

Make every effort to keep yourselves united in the Spirit, binding yourselves together with peace. Ephesians 4:3

Be aware that preferences are not principles.

Do nothing from selfish ambition or conceit, but in humility count others more significant than yourselves. Philippians 2:3

Be deliberate to connect over common interests not common enemies.
How good and pleasant it is when God’s people live together in unity! Psalm 133:1


2/ We should share our hearts and hear their hearts. (v.32)

Be quick to listen.

Be slow to speak…but speak!
Be sure to hold confidence.

“What happens in Life Group, stays in Life Group.”


3/ We should seize spiritual opportunities. (v.33)

Be sure to invite the presence of Jesus into the room.

Be watchful for “God Moments”.

Be willing to practice your spiritual gifts.


4/ We should set a gracious atmosphere. (v.33)

Be quick to overlook offenses or frustrations.

Make allowance for each other’s faults, and forgive anyone who offends you. Remember, the Lord forgave you, so you must forgive others. Colossians 3:13

Love each other deeply, because love covers a multitude of sins. 1 Peter 4:8

Be willing to assume the best of others.

“Assume something is happening in their life that you aren’t aware of.” Pastor Chitty

Be a source of encouragement.

Therefore encourage one another and build one another up. 1 Thessalonians 5:11


5/ We should serve with compassion and care. (v.34)

Be mindful of practical needs.

Koinonia says: “Lord, help me to see what needs I need to fill.”

Make the effort to contribute, not just consume.
Be mindful of personal needs.

Share each other’s burdens. Galatians 6:2
